    iBleat - a channel dedicated to customer service dialogue

    Developed by South African entrepreneurs, iBleat is a recently released app that privately connects customers with any business, brand or outlet in an effort to simplify customer service. According to the company, the aim of iBleat is to continue to draw customers away from social media and chat apps, and encourage the use of its free, private, secure and dedicated customer service channel.
    iBleat - a channel dedicated to customer service dialogue

    While social media seems to be the go-to platform for customer feedback – 67% of all social media posts relate to customer service – posts can often be jumped on and derailed by a large number of other users.

    According to iBleat CEO Grant Campbell, social media has its drawbacks. "Businesses have to monitor, mine and search social media for posts directed to them. Social media posts may get incorrectly tagged and fall through the cracks, thus not reaching the company. This compounds an existing problem as 60% of consumers who reach out to a business on social media expect a response within 1 hour or less (Sykes). Should they not receive that response their dissatisfaction increases. From our experience posting publicly usually occurs when an issue has not been satisfactorily resolved and posts are out of frustration, with the need to name and shame.

    "Following this – and likely as a result of these drawbacks – we have seen WeChat, WhatsApp and Messenger enter the market, allowing customers to contact businesses to open a chat conversation, while some businesses have launched their own chat applications. These chat options have proved themselves for individual and group chat communication but have not been designed as a specific customer care solution. Rather, they are merely a platform to open a dialogue between a customer and business."

    Consumer and business benefits

    iBleat lists the following benefits of the app:

    • You don’t have to search for a business’s details.
    • Bleats are private and secure and are correctly directed, while retaining the ability for you to share to Facebook or Twitter should an issue not be satisfactorily resolved.
    • Businesses can instantly respond, with the full Bleat info increasing their ability to engage effectively.
    • Contributes to the decluttering of social media.
    • Integration with customer relationship management tools such as Zendesk, Salesforce, etc. is possible.
    • Businesses may pass credits, coupons and QR codes within iBleat to a user.
    • A full history and database enables businesses to interpret all customer interactions.

    "We believe that more good happens than bad and iBleat creates an easy platform to recognise good service."
